Stephanie Hemphill reports a group of experts are designing efficiency at Duluth conference:
"More than 1,000 builders, architects, and homeowners are learning about energy-efficient design at the Energy Design Conference in Duluth this week."

A party line vote (44 to 22) removed Molnau as commissioner of the Minnesota Department of Transportation. She is still lieutenant governor. (MPR: Senate dismisses transportation chief Molnau)
